What Is the Cost of Living Near Santa Barbara?

Understanding the cost of living near Santa Barbara is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Sunset Management Services.
Santa Barbara's Cost of Living Index is approximately 204.1 (104.1% more expensive than US average; 46.0% more than CA average). 'American Riviera', extremely desirable coastal city with exceptionally high housing costs and overall high cost of living. When planning your budget based on a salary from Sunset Management Services,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$2,800 - $4,500+ A significant portion of Sunset Management Services sal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$170 - $280 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$52 (MTD mon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$500 - $780 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$550 - $1,100+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$440 - $830+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$4,512 - $7,492+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
